+// Wallet represents a software or hardware wallet that might contain one or more
+// accounts (derived from the same seed).
+type Wallet interface {
+ // Type retrieves a textual representation of the type of the wallet.
+ Type() string
+
+ // URL retrieves the canonical path under which this wallet is reachable. It is
+ // user by upper layers to define a sorting order over all wallets from multiple
+ // backends.
+ URL() string
+
+ // Status returns a textual status to aid the user in the current state of the
+ // wallet.
+ Status() string
+
+ // Open initializes access to a wallet instance. It is not meant to unlock or
+ // decrypt account keys, rather simply to establish a connection to hardware
+ // wallets and/or to access derivation seeds.
+ //
+ // The passphrase parameter may or may not be used by the implementation of a
+ // particular wallet instance. The reason there is no passwordless open method
+ // is to strive towards a uniform wallet handling, oblivious to the different
+ // backend providers.
+ //
+ // Please note, if you open a wallet, you must close it to release any allocated
+ // resources (especially important when working with hardware wallets).
+ Open(passphrase string) error
+
+ // Close releases any resources held by an open wallet instance.
+ Close() error
+
+ // Accounts retrieves the list of signing accounts the wallet is currently aware
+ // of. For hierarchical deterministic wallets, the list will not be exhaustive,
+ // rather only contain the accounts explicitly pinned during account derivation.
+ Accounts() []Account
+
+ // Contains returns whether an account is part of this particular wallet or not.
+ Contains(account Account) bool
+
+ // Derive attempts to explicitly derive a hierarchical deterministic account at
+ // the specified derivation path. If requested, the derived account will be added
+ // to the wallet's tracked account list.
+ Derive(path string, pin bool) (Account, error)
+
+ // SignHash requests the wallet to sign the given hash.
+ //
+ // It looks up the account specified either solely via its address contained within,
+ // or optionally with the aid of any location metadata from the embedded URL field.
+ //
+ // If the wallet requires additional authentication to sign the request (e.g.
+ // a password to decrypt the account, or a PIN code o verify the transaction),
+ // an AuthNeededError instance will be returned, containing infos for the user
+ // about which fields or actions are needed. The user may retry by providing
+ // the needed details via SignHashWithPassphrase, or by other means (e.g. unlock
+ // the account in a keystore).
+ SignHash(account Account, hash []byte) ([]byte, error)
+
+ // SignTx requests the wallet to sign the given transaction.
+ //
+ // It looks up the account specified either solely via its address contained within,
+ // or optionally with the aid of any location metadata from the embedded URL field.
+ //
+ // If the wallet requires additional authentication to sign the request (e.g.
+ // a password to decrypt the account, or a PIN code o verify the transaction),
+ // an AuthNeededError instance will be returned, containing infos for the user
+ // about which fields or actions are needed. The user may retry by providing
+ // the needed details via SignTxWithPassphrase, or by other means (e.g. unlock
+ // the account in a keystore).
+ SignTx(account Account, tx *types.Transaction, chainID *big.Int) (*types.Transaction, error)
+
+ // SignHashWithPassphrase requests the wallet to sign the given hash with the
+ // given passphrase as extra authentication information.
+ //
+ // It looks up the account specified either solely via its address contained within,
+ // or optionally with the aid of any location metadata from the embedded URL field.
+ SignHashWithPassphrase(account Account, passphrase string, hash []byte) ([]byte, error)
+
+ // SignTxWithPassphrase requests the wallet to sign the given transaction, with the
+ // given passphrase as extra authentication information.
+ //
+ // It looks up the account specified either solely via its address contained within,
+ // or optionally with the aid of any location metadata from the embedded URL field.
+ SignTxWithPassphrase(account Account, passphrase string, tx *types.Transaction, chainID *big.Int) (*types.Transaction, error)
}

+// Backend is a "wallet provider" that may contain a batch of accounts they can
+// sign transactions with and upon request, do so.
+type Backend interface {
+ // Wallets retrieves the list of wallets the backend is currently aware of.
+ //
+ // The returned wallets are not opened by default. For software HD wallets this
+ // means that no base seeds are decrypted, and for hardware wallets that no actual
+ // connection is established.
+ //
+ // The resulting wallet list will be sorted alphabetically based on its internal
+ // URL assigned by the backend. Since wallets (especially hardware) may come and
+ // go, the same wallet might appear at a different positions in the list during
+ // subsequent retrievals.
+ Wallets() []Wallet
+
+ // Subscribe creates an async subscription to receive notifications when the
+ // backend detects the arrival or departure of a wallet.
+ Subscribe(sink chan<- WalletEvent) event.Subscription
}
